Care Force: Iraq veteran paired up with 'his help'
In the 2000s, Jay Cook was deployed to Iraq, and when he returned from overseas, things changed for the soldier, who was later diagnosed with PTSD and a traumatic brain injury. Thanks to a group called K9s for Warriors, Cook found a new best friend that he now calls 'his help.' FOX 10's Christina Carilla reports.

Phoenix area Elks Lodge marks Flag Day
June 14 is Flag Day, which commemorates the day the Continental Congress approved the design of the American flag in 1777. While Flag Day was made an official day by President Harry Truman in 1949, the Elks Lodge has had a tradition of observing Flag Day that dates back to 1908, and that tradition is still alive at the group's Fountain Hills location.

Arizona veterans arrive in D.C. for Honor Flight
Veterans from the Valley arrived in Washington D.C. on Wednesday. They're in our nation's capitol ahead of Memorial Day Weekend as part of an Honor Flight. These war heroes departed from Phoenix Sky Harbor surrounded by cheering crowds. Their trip to D.C. is a chance to honor the lives lost in battles and to see the memorials that represent what they fought for. These are veterans from World War II, Korea and Vietnam. Some of them fought in all three.
